> > > Please consider adding the following two devices to the devlist in
> > > scsi_dc_rdac.c
> > >
> > > {"STK", "FLEXLINE 380"},
> > > {"SUN", "CSM_100_R_FC"},
> > >
> > > The Flexline 380 is also now known as the Sun StorageTek 6540, and the
> > > CSM_100_R_FC is also known as the Sun StorEdge 6130 - both are
> rebranded
> > > LSI arrays.
